The Southern University at New Orleans, or SUNO, is a 17-acre large university in New Orleans, Louisiana. Founded in 1956, the school is considered as a Historically black college or university (HCBY) in the United States. Despite this, SUNO hosts more than just African-Americans but also students from all over the globe. The university has provided undergraduate and graduate level programs and top-notch student services for arts, sports, and recreation.

Tuition Fees at Southern University at New Orleans

Southern University at New Orleans tuition fees for both bachelor's and master's students are discussed in this section.

Bachelor's Tuition Fees

Student Type Annual Tuition Fees in USD
Domestic Students 7,512 USD - 8,900 USD
International Students 8,900 USD

Master's Tuition Fees

Student Type Annual Tuition Fees in USD
Domestic Students 6,942 USD - 9,378 USD
International Students 9,378 USD
